Chief Deputy

Shelby County Sheriff’S Office

Memphis, Tn

Accountable for day-to-day operations of the largest Sheriff’s office in the state of Tennessee.• Oversaw strategic planning and overall management of the Sheriff’s Office. Directed the development and implementation of the law enforcement division goals and objectives.• Directed coordination of Sheriff's Office activities with other county departments, private businesses; citizen groups; and local, state, and federal agencies.• Oversaw an intelligence-driven approach to analyzing crime patterns (Data Smart Policing), which I developed and refined, to effectively and efficiently position resources to reduce crime. This resulted in a 22% reduction in crime throughout our jurisdiction.• Directed and oversaw development and implementation of a $152 million budget.• Developed, planned, implemented and administered Sheriff's Office goals and objectives and policies and procedures; approveed new or modified programs, systems, policies and procedures.• Chaired committees and boards that directly affected the Sheriff's Office's operations. These included: Sheriff’s Strategic Planning Committee, Personnel Early Warning System Committee, Adult-oriented Business Committee, Special Deputy Commission Committee, Sexual Harassment Prevention Team, Executive Board, and the Crash Review Board.• Served as an Executive Governing Board Member of Juvenile Detention Alternative Initiative (JDAI), and as a member of the Memphis/Shelby County Domestic and Sexual Violence Council, the Family Safety Center Operation Committee, the Shelby County Retirement Board; and as a board member of "The Blueprint Project,"​ a domestic violence prevention that provides a multidisciplinary, multi-law enforcement approach to combating violence.• Represented the Sheriff's Office on community outreach initiatives such as Impact Ministries, the Memphis Women's Council, and Operation Safe Community.• Served as chief negotiator for all personnel/union issues.

Sep 2010 - Jul 2015

Director (Assistant Chief), Bureau Of Professional Standards And Integrity

Shelby County Sheriff’S Office

Memphis, Tn

In 2003, I created a new bureau comprising three distinct sections: Administrative Investigations (formerly internal affairs), Disciplinary Review, and Commissions and Compliance. Streamlining the bureau increased its effectiveness and efficiency. Under my direction, the entire disciplinary system process was revamped, the administrative investigative process was updated, including implementation of an IAB reporting program; and procedures were created to register individuals associated with adult-oriented businesses and to register, monitor, and enforce laws pertaining to sexual offenders. Day-to-day responsibilities included:• Reporting directly to the Sheriff, advising him on personnel issues and assisting with development and implementation of the Sheriff’s goals and objectives. Recommending appointments of, and training, motivating and evaluating staff; establishing and monitoring employee performance objectives.• Developing, planning, implementing and administering the Bureau’s goals and objectives as well as policies and procedures; approving new or modified programs, systems, policies and procedures; directing, overseeing and participating in development of the Bureau work plan; assigning work activities and programs; reviewing and evaluating work products, methods and procedures; overseeing preparation of staff reports and other correspondence; overseeing development and maintenance of processes and procedures pertaining to administrative case investigation, background checks, off-duty employment, retired and special deputies and disciplinary review; implementing and overseeing the Sexual Offender Program, including offender registration, compliance checks and, if necessary, arrest and prosecution; providing training and direction regarding discipline and employee issues; coordinating Bureau activities with other internal bureaus, divisions, and outside agencies.• Serving on various committees and boards within the Sheriff’s Office

2003 - 2010 ~7 yrs
